Trip 2 - Day 3 Its Official!!

This morning the judge officially decreed that David and I are Zach's parents! We were so happy to hear those words. Court in a foreign country even for "good" is still stressful - the desire to say the right words and to show the right respect with out being patronizing, is all very stressful. But we made it thanks to "V".

There were no smiles in the court room and everything was very intense. We were very very lucky - our proceedings took about 30-45 minutes. The judge reviewed all of our documents and we were asked questions by the prosecutor. When the judge left the room to deliberate the social worker from the baby home and the prosecutor all smiled and cooed over the photos we took for the court to review. Which was good because I was really worried when we got no emotions at all over the pictures.

I could write a book just on court today. SOOOO long story short we are Zach's parents and we are just over whelmed with joy and happiness. We confirmed today that offical physical custody will be May 5th.

After we finished with court we went to the adoption agency office and then we went to the notary's office and did some paperwork. So that was one more thing done!

We ended today with a celebatory dinner at TGI-Friday with the couple from NY and a trip to the grocery store. Fun times had by all.

It was a great day and a long day. Dave is supposed to be working on putting some pictures up. Hopefully he will do that soon! Please keep us in your prayers.
